How to Verify a Mr Sweepy Sweepstakes Is Legitimate
To avoid scams and deceptive promotions, verify that a Mr Sweepy Sweepstakes is official by checking the sponsoring brand’s verified website and social channels, reviewing the posted official rules, and confirming that entry instructions point to a secure, properly branded page. Warning signs of fraudulent promotions include requests for payment to enter, promises of guaranteed outcomes, unusual personal information requests, and poorly designed pages with spelling or grammar errors. If in doubt, contact the brand’s customer service directly using contact details from their verified public site. Reputable companies will clarify whether a promotion exists and will not ask winners to pay fees before receiving prizes.
Red Flags of Suspicious Promotions
- Entry requires payment, wire transfers, or gift cards.
- Unsolicited messages demanding immediate action to claim a prize.
- Poor grammar, unofficial domains, or missing official branding.
Tax Considerations and Claim Procedures for Winners
In many jurisdictions, prizes and sweepstakes winnings are considered taxable income, and winners may receive a form reporting the value of the award for tax purposes. The specifics depend on local tax law, the value of the prize, and whether the award is treated as income or a product discount. Claim procedures typically involve confirming eligibility, providing contact or identification details, and following instructions for prize delivery or redemption. Winners should retain any documentation related to entry and prize notification, in case questions arise with tax authorities or during the fulfillment process.
General Guidance on Reporting Sweepstakes Income
- Check local regulations to determine whether prizes must be reported as income.
- Keep records of entry confirmations and prize correspondence.
- Contact a tax professional for advice on how to handle prize value reporting.
